My mother’s will says her boyfriend can live in her home after she dies. Can I still kick him out if the deed is transferred to me?

0


Dear Moneyist,

My mother currently owns a beautiful home in Virginia Beach that is paid for; she inherited a very sizable number of assets from her late husband. In her will, she would like to leave the house to me, but has stipulated that her boyfriend can remain in the house indefinitely, although he will have to pay utilities. The will also stipulates that he cannot have another woman living in the house.
